Effective Sketching Techniques

Effective sketches require a common understanding among team members, utilizing consistent vocabulary and clear notation. Simon emphasizes the importance of simplicity in diagrams and the need for clarity in communication, highlighting the disconnect often found between architectural diagrams and actual code. By ensuring that diagrams are easily understandable to outsiders, teams can bridge the gap between architecture and implementation.